Tioki is a combination social network for educators and job search service. It will appeal to younger teachers who are learning their way into the profession. The profile elements help new teachers highlight their skills. While I concentrate on E-Learning, I wanted to curate this interesting social network based job search site. Young teachers are a precious commodity. Those saavy enough to use this service well have already distinguished themselves as above average. If you are planning to create a visual CV for yourself soon, do not waste your time trying out the many cool alternative tools that are available out there to create one, like Easel.ly, LinkedIN Resume Builder, Vizify, Infogr.am and several others. In my view, even if you use a fancy visualization tool, what makes the most difference is having a unique visual "idea" to support the presentation of your credentials. This is why I suggest that, if you have the fancy and skills to create your own visual CV, there is no better resource for inspiration that I know of, than this huge Pinterest collection by Randy Krum. If you are an author, blogger or journalist and you would like to create an online professional portoflio of your best work, here is a free service that provides a simple, but excellent personal branding and news portofolio service: Pressfolios. You provide URLs for the articles and clips you have already published and Pressfolios crawls out to grab its key meta-data and makes it easy for you to integrate it in the free one-page profiler that Pressfolio creates automatically for you. You can create different sections of your content clips as to organize them according to different topics / industries / issues / years / publishers. Last but not least Pressfolios automatically helps you create a profile page for yourself to support your content showcase, in which you can list your "professional focus", skills, social networks you are active on, and some kind of text introduction alongside an image of yours and a theme-image that you can also choose for yourself. (From the article): And it doesn't stop there: according to StartWire.com, one of the web's top sites for job searching, "Referrals are the #1 source of hires in corporate America today. And, recent research shows that 'referral' hires not only stay in their jobs longer but that they perform better over the long term."

"Four units comprise the curriculum resources. Each unit consists of standalone yet complementary lesson plans that play off a creative rights scenario presented through a case study. Each unit has 4-6 of these project-oriented activities, one of which serves as the culminating lesson for the unit. Guiding questions help set the expectation for what students learn, and pre/post assessments establish baseline knowledge to gauge student learning. Modification and Extension suggestions recommend ways to abridge or expand the activities within the unit, and provide tips for engaging parents and peers outside of the classroom. Our children are growing up in a digital world that is completely foreign to how we grew up. We didn't have the Internet as a ubiquitous prescence in our lives. To make things worse, the landscape keeps changing on us, the parents, and the children. It is now, more than ever, crucial to teach our children how to be more than "street smart."
It used to be that having street smarts was helpful, because that way you could protect yourself from being taken advantage of. It carries an element of shrewdness, for one's own protection this is a good thing. Nowadays we need to apply that online. Delete the scoop?

Online teachers learn to live with great online transparency. It's wise to Google yourself, and become more aware of just how you 'look' on the Internet. Professionals do this all the time. But kids don't. As teachers we often learn best by teaching a subject. Are digital footprints someting likely to show up in your curriculum?
